WebThis neglected apple tree is 24 feet tall and has a spread of 24 feet (only half the tree is shown). Because the trunk is fairly solid and the tree is basically healthy, it can be … how i dealt with it作文WebPrune out all dead, diseased, and broken branches. Lower the height of the tree by heading back large, upright-growing scaffold branches to outward-growing laterals.
